828° nh Image5c Chocolate (223). Mint N.H., mathematically perfect centering with Jumbo margins, deep rich color on crisp paper, long and full perforations

EXTREMELY FINE GEM. THIS MAGNIFICENT MINT NEVER-HINGED EXAMPLE OF THE 5-CENT 1890 ISSUE IS GRADED GEM 100 JUMBO BY P.S.E. -- THIS IS THE HIGHEST GRADE POSSIBLE ON THE GRADING CHART. TRULY A CONDITION RARITY.

With 1992 P.F. and 2005 P.S.E. certificates (Gem 100 Jumbo; unpriced in SMQ above the grade of 100, SMQ $14,500.00 as 100). This is the highest grade possible on the grading chart and only one other Scott 223 shares this grade. In fact, there are no other Mint N.H. stamps graded 100J among all the denominations of the 1890-93 Issue (Image)
